Anduril Industries develops advanced defense systems for the United States and allied nations. Their Lattice OS platform unifies multiple data streams into a real-time 3D command center, enabling military teams to make informed decisions quickly. The Maneuver Dominance team at Anduril works on multi-asset autonomy, connecting platforms such as Ghost and Altius, and extending functionality through integration with third-party systems.

Role overview

The Senior Flight Test Engineer - Advanced Defense Technology will focus on testing and evaluating Group 3 Unmanned Aircraft Systems (UAS). This work supports both internal product development and customer demonstrations. The role has a direct impact on the reliability and safety of new autonomous defense technologies, shaping how these systems perform in real-world battlefield conditions.
